Why Expert Window Installation Matters
The procedure of window installation is far more complicated than it appears. An ill-fitted window can lead to problems such as drafts, moisture invasion, or structural problems. Therefore, engaging expert window installers is crucial for numerous reasons:

Quality Workmanship
Expert installers have years of experience and training, which translates into remarkable workmanship. They understand the nuances of various window types and installation techniques.

Time Efficiency
Professional installers can finish the task quicker than an unskilled individual. This conserves house owners time and lessens inconvenience.

Informed Decision-Making
Experienced window installers are fluent in the current window technologies and trends, supplying homeowners with important insights about the best alternatives for their specific needs.

Service warranty Protection
Numerous window producers use service warranties that require professional installation. Engaging an expert ensures that the warranty stays valid.

Security
Window installation can involve heavy lifting, ladders, and risky maneuvers. Specialists are trained in using devices securely, lowering the opportunities of accidents.

Comprehending the steps associated with window installation can help property owners value the skill and competence needed for the task. Below is a basic summary of the procedure:

Consultation and Measurement
The installer visits the website to determine existing windows and talk about designs, materials, and budget plans with the homeowner.

Material Selection
Property owners select from a range of window designs, materials, and features according to their choices and budget plan.

Window Removal
The old windows are thoroughly gotten rid of, making sure that surrounding areas stay intact.

Frame Preparation
The window frames are examined and repaired if necessary. This might involve fixing any water damage or rot.

Installation
New windows are installed, typically using foam insulation and caulk to make sure an airtight seal.

Completing Touches
Trims and sashes are reattached, and any spaces are sealed. Installers clean the website and remove any particles.

Final Inspection
The installer conducts a final inspection with the homeowner to make sure fulfillment.
